Walk the Caprera island coastal trail

Najbolje vreme za posetu

Late afternoon for golden light on the granite, with far fewer hikers than morning. Spring and fall offer mild temperatures and wildflowers that carpet the inland sections.

Saveti za budžet

Access to the trail is completely free, no tickets required. Parking near the bridge to Caprera costs 5 euro for the day, or park in Palau and take the bus for 1.50 euro each way.

O atrakciji

Brze činjenice: Obalna staza duga 12 kilometara kruži oko ostrva na kojem je Đuzepe Garibaldi proveo svoje poslednje godine, a njegova jednostavna bela kuća i dalje je vidljiva sa staze. Granitne gromade veličine automobila obrubljuju obalu, oblikovane vetrom u forme koje se menjaju sa svakom olujom.

Istaknuto: Dobro pogledajte granitne formacije blizu istočne strane i primetićete prirodne bazene izdubljene morskom prskom, od kojih neki drže morsku vodu koja svetluca kao tečni tirkiz. Lokalni ribari ih zovu "džinovskim kadama" i u mirnim danima voda odražava nebo tako savršeno da ne možete da odredite gde se stena završava, a oblaci počinju.

Insajderski saveti

  • Start clockwise from the bridge for dramatic coastal views first, saving the wooded inland stretch for the return.
  • Wear sturdy shoes: the granite sections get polished smooth by wind and can be slippery near the water.
  • The only drinking water tap is at the Garibaldi museum entrance, so carry at least 1.5 liters per person.
  • Bring a swimsuit and towel, some of the most swimmable coves like Cala Portese are mid-trail with zero crowds.
